Hi Everyone,

When I try to send multiple http requests to my FrontController (ie bypassing EntryPont Editor) I was abe to pesist many requests in the datastore with:

registerPackages(resourceSet.getPackageRegistry());
resource = resourceSet.getResource(URI.createURI("datastore:/SessionLog"),true);

options.put(URIConverter.OPTION_UPDATE_ONLY_IF_TIME_STAMP_MATCHES,resource.getTimeStamp());
resource.getContents().add(commSession);
try{
resource.save(options);
}catch (IOException e){
System.out.println(e.getLocalizedMessage());
}



until I got these two types of errors:

TYPE I
Failed to save datastore:/SessionLog

TYPE II
java.util.ConcurrentModificationException: too much contention on these datastore entities. please try again.

Pasquale,

It's hard to comment about the behavior of the Google AppEngine itself.
I'm not sure there's any discussion about commit producing this
particular exception. Perhaps there is a mechanism in place to prevent
what would amount to a DoS attack by overuse. I.e., if the rate at
which the requests for new commits comes in faster than the ability of
the engine to actually do the commits, some queue (one that's
sequentializing the transactions) is likely to overfill...

Hi Ed,

I should decribe the process at the java client (the user is actually a system). The system(or "user") is a communication app polling a local file directory. Each http session is a single file transfer to GAE using http post. A single user's polling directory can have hundreds files and the java client can spawn multiple http sessions each executing a single http post. Aggregating the volume across hundreds of "users" and you can get tens of thousands of file transfer requests. Keep in mind the "the user" is a system that just needs a single http response to end the session. I want to save the payload to the datastore and end the session as fast as possible.

On my side I will then process the payload after the session ends using task queues.

So, to answer your question the datastore:/SessionLog is shared across all users but I could create one per user but then I have hundreds(users) of datastores. No?

I do expect to queue the requests when the volume hits these large numbers but wanted to see how much I can get without queuing at this time by using the EMF/GWT components available.

Hi Ed,

Each user is only adding a new session entity to the datastore - never changing existing entities. I never need to access the other entities but the only way I know to save the new entity correctly is:

resource = resourceSet.getResource(URI.createURI("datastore:/SessionLog"),true);

then adding a new entity to it:

resource.getContents().add(commSession);

and then save. Is there a way to save the new entity without loading the resource? I tried createResource without loading but when I save I lose previous saved entities and I tried
resource = resourceSet.getResource(URI.createURI("datastore:/SessionLog"),true);

resource.unload();

and got the same result as createResource.

When you say,
"I think each user's session should be saved under a different entity and
then you can query all those entities to produce an aggregate."

How would you construct the URI and prepare the resource before executing the resource.getContents().add command on the entity? Append obj.Hashcode() to the URI?

Pasquale,

Comments below.

On 17/01/2012 10:38 PM, Pasquale Gervasi wrote:
> Hi Ed,
>
> Each user is only adding a new session entity to the datastore - never
> changing existing entities. I never need to access the other entities
> but the only way I know to save the new entity correctly is:
>
> resource =
> resourceSet.getResource(URI.createURI("datastore:/SessionLog"),true);
You show a fixed URI that everyone shares because it's the same for
everyone. It doesn't make sense to load one if you expect this to be
new information.
>
> then adding a new entity to it:
>
> resource.getContents().add(commSession);
>
> and then save. Is there a way to save the new entity without loading
> the resource?
Use a different URI for each client and each session. Have a look at
DatastoreUtil.OPTION_SESSION to see how that approach stores everything
under session-specific keys.
> I tried createResource without loading but when I save I lose previous
> saved entities and I tried
> resource =
> resourceSet.getResource(URI.createURI("datastore:/SessionLog"),true);
>
> resource.unload();
>
> and got the same result as createResource.
Keep in mind what OPTION_UPDATE_ONLY_IF_TIME_STAMP_MATCHES. Your save
will fail if the time stamp in the data store doesn't match the given
time stamp. But of course for a resource that's new , it's not in the
repo and using this option will fail every time. Don't use that
option unless your saving changes you made to a resource you loaded and
which you want to overwrite the previous version you loaded.
>
> When you say, "I think each user's session should be saved under a
> different entity and then you can query all those entities to produce
> an aggregate."
>
> How would you construct the URI and prepare the resource before
> executing the resource.getContents().add command on the entity?
For a new resource, the URI matters only when you save it.
> Append obj.Hashcode() to the URI?
How will you want to identify sessions later when you make use of them?
If you included the user identity and perhaps a creation timestamp as
part of the URI (the time the session you're recording started perhaps),
you'd end up with something unique. Using EcoreUtil.generateUUID is
another approach.
